AWP Conference Panel: Minneapolis Convention Center, MN

Room 101 B&C, Level 1: The Flash Fiction Marketplace: What Editors are Looking for. (Tom Hazuka,  Kim Chinquee,  Meg Tuite,  Lex Williford) Since 1992, when the Flash Fiction anthology gave the genre a catchy name that stuck, flash fiction’s popularity has soared with both writers and readers. Numerous popular anthologies have followed, along with many flash fiction books by individual writers, and a vibrant online publishing scene including journals devoted exclusively to the form. Four well-known writers and editors will discuss flash fiction from creation to publication, with particular emphasis on what makes editors say “yes.”
